Ques. What is the difference between B.Tech AI & Data Science and B.Tech AI & Machine Learning at Apex University?
Ans. Both programmes are offered under the Faculty of Engineering and Technology at Apex University and share a significant overlap in core subjects such as Machine Learning, Deep Learning, Python Programming, and Data Analytics. The B.Tech in AI & Data Science places greater emphasis on data engineering, big data technologies, statistical modelling, and data-driven decision-making, while B.Tech in AI & Machine Learning focuses more on ML algorithms, neural networks, computer vision, and robotics. Students interested in careers as Data Scientists, Data Engineers, or Business Analysts may prefer AI & DS, while those targeting roles as ML Engineers or AI Researchers may prefer AIML. Both programmes have strong placement support and industry connections at Apex University.
Ques. Is CUET UG mandatory for admission to B.Tech AI & Data Science at Apex University?
Ans. No, CUET UG is not mandatory. Apex University fills 50% of its B.Tech seats through CUET UG merit and the remaining 50% through AUCET (Apex University Common Entrance Test). Candidates who have not appeared for CUET UG can apply directly through AUCET, which is conducted by the university itself in multiple phases between May and July 2026. JEE Main scores are accepted for scholarship purposes but are not a mandatory admission requirement. This makes Apex University accessible to a wider pool of students.
Ques. What programming languages and tools are taught in the B.Tech AI & Data Science programme?
Ans. The curriculum covers Python (primary language for AI/ML), R Programming, C (in first year), Java (Object Oriented Programming), SQL and Data Analytics using SQL, and web technologies. Key tools and frameworks covered include libraries for Machine Learning and Deep Learning (such as TensorFlow, Keras, and scikit-learn), data visualization tools, and platforms for chatbot development and computer vision. Students also work on real-world projects using these tools during their mini project (Semester 5), project-based internship (Semester 7), and major project (Semester 8).

Ques. Can I get a scholarship if I scored 85% in Class 12 and also have a good CUET score?
Ans. Yes, you are eligible for scholarships under both the Merit-Based scheme (12th marks) and the CUET-based scheme. However, a student cannot avail multiple scholarships simultaneously at Apex University, except for the Early Bird Registration (EBR) scholarship which can be combined with one other scheme. In your case, with 85% in Class 12, you would be eligible for a 20% merit scholarship (75%-89.99% slab). If your CUET percentile is between 85-89.99, you would be eligible for a 30% CUET scholarship. You would receive the higher of the two (30% CUET scholarship), and you could additionally claim the 10% EBR scholarship if you register and pay the first instalment by May 31, 2026, giving you a combined 40% scholarship on the tuition fee.
Ques. What is the hostel fee and is it mandatory for B.Tech students at Apex University?
Ans. Hostel accommodation is not mandatory for B.Tech students at Apex University. The campus is located at V.T. Road, Sector-5, Mansarovar, Jaipur, which is well-connected by public transport. For students who wish to stay on campus, hostel rooms are available at approximately Rs. 15,000 per semester for non-AC rooms (excluding food charges). The hostel has separate facilities for male and female students, with amenities including Wi-Fi, common rooms, and sports facilities. Students can apply for hostel accommodation at apexuniversityjaipur.ac.in/Facility-Form/. Hostel fees are not covered under any scholarship scheme.
